EVP, Investor Relations & Corporate Development

This position is posted by Jobgether on behalf of a partner company. We are currently looking for an EVP, Investor Relations & Corporate Development in United States.

In this senior executive role, you will help define and communicate the long-term value story of a fast-scaling global AI-driven platform operating at the intersection of technology, professional services, and human expertise. You will act as a strategic partner to the CEO, shaping corporate strategy, investor messaging, and growth narratives that connect financial performance with enterprise vision. This is a highly visible, market-facing leadership position where you will engage directly with investors, analysts, board members, and strategic partners. You will also play a key role in corporate development initiatives, helping identify and execute opportunities that accelerate growth and strengthen the company’s portfolio. Operating in a fast-paced, founder-led environment, you will influence both strategic direction and external perception at the highest level. This role is designed for a leader who thrives on building relationships, shaping markets, and translating complexity into compelling value creation stories.

Accountabilities:
  • Define and execute the company’s investor relations and strategic finance narrative to support long-term enterprise value creation
  • Partner with the CEO to develop and communicate a compelling business story to investors, board members, analysts, and external stakeholders
  • Build, refine, and optimize financial and operating models across multi-channel business lines (B2C, B2B, marketplace, and digital services)
  • Lead corporate development initiatives, including evaluation and execution of strategic partnerships, acquisitions, and growth opportunities
  • Expand and manage relationships with investors, analysts, advisors, and strategic ecosystem partners to enhance visibility and credibility
  • Identify and unlock value across business units, brands, and markets to support portfolio optimization and growth strategy
  • Oversee strategic readiness, ensuring financial insights and operational clarity support high-quality decision-making
  • Mentor and develop a high-performing team focused on strategic finance, corporate development, and market-facing execution

Requirements:

  • 15+ years of experience in investor relations, corporate development, strategic finance, investment banking, private equity, or top-tier consulting
  • Proven ability to shape and communicate compelling value-creation narratives to investors, boards, and senior stakeholders
  • Strong background in corporate development, capital markets, M&A, or strategic growth roles with operational exposure preferred
  • Experience working with digital, subscription-based, B2C, B2B, or marketplace business models
  • Strong executive presence with the ability to influence at board and investor level
  • Demonstrated ability to connect financial performance with strategic vision and business storytelling
  • Strong relationship-building skills with a proactive approach to external engagement and network expansion
  • MBA or advanced degree preferred
  • Ability to thrive in fast-paced, founder-led, high-growth environments
